Ellie Hudson-Heck contributed a season-high six points (5 goals, 1 assist) to lead The College of Wooster to a 14-7 win over DePauw University on Sunday in a North Coast Athletic Conference women's lacrosse match-up at Greencastle, Ind.

The Fighting Scots (2-6, 2-2 NCAC) only outshot the Tigers (3-7, 2-3 NCAC) by three, 27-24, but they made their opportunities count. Wooster scored on three of its first six shots of the game, as Ashley Parry, Abby Szlachta, and Hudson-Heck gave the Scots a 3-0 lead 6:54 into the action.

DePauw pulled as close as 4-3 midway through the first half, but Wooster went into the break on a 5-2 scoring run, which included the second, third, and fourth goals of the game for Hudson-Heck, which made it 9-5 at the halftime break.

The contest became much more about defense in the second half, as each team fired off just 10 shots, but again Wooster was more efficient. Shelby Stone put the Scots in double-figures at 10-5, and after DePauw pulled back within four (10-6), Wooster scored four unanswered goals to pull away for good.

Wooster struggled on draw controls in the game, winning just eight of 23, but it was able to use it success on clears (15-for-20) and three free-position goals to create an advantage over its opponent.

Goalkeeper Isabel Perman was also a factor, making nine saves in goal while allowing her second-lowest goals against of the spring.

Offensively, Hudson-Heck was the headliner, but Szlachta (4 goals) and Stone (2 goals, 3 assists) were also very much involved.
